North Korean airline Air Koryo has resumed commercial flights with China and Russia after years of pandemic-related restrictions.
An Air Koryo plane is seen at Beijing Capital Airport. North Korea's first international commercial flight in three years landed in Beijing on Aug. 22.
Air Koryo, North Korea's state-operated airline, has begun operating three flights a week from Pyongyang's airport to Beijing. The first flight arrived with few inbound passengers but returned to the hermit kingdom with approximately 400 North Korean nationals who have stayed in ChinaA second flight arrived Saturday – once again with limited travelers to China – and returned with more than 100 North Koreans previously staying in China.
